Widely adored by Grand Prix fans for his tremendous talent, AMA Motorcycle Hall of Fame Rider Giacomo Agostini, or "Ago," as he is famously nicknamed, will be honored this year by the Legend of the Motorcycle with a very special Lifetime Achievement Award. This accolade will be bestowed to him in recognition for his vast success in racing and his myriad of contributions to the motorcycle industry. Arguably the most successful motorcycle racer of all-time, Ago is responsible for an unprecedented fifteen motorcycle Grand Prix Championships, most riding for MV Agusta Founder, Count Domenico Agusta. Also on hand from MV Agusta will be the current flagship in Italian motorcycle performance and design, the handmade $120,000 F4CC superbike, championed by MV Agusta's own Claudio Castiglioni. With only 99 examples produced and conceived as a bike without equal, the F4CC combines top of the line performance with the very best in design.
To compliment the new Brutale and fine modern day bikes such as the F4CC, MV Agusta will also be joining JeanRichard watches in showcasing their stunning new MV 75 World Champion Collection. Made to echo the color and beauty of MV Agusta motorcycles, the lavish limited- edition collection from the highly respected watch manufacturer is made to commemorate MV Agusta's 75 international competition victories. The spectacular series is composed of three distinctly different MV chronographs available in rose gold (75 pieces), titanium (175 pieces), and steel (575 pieces). Equipped with the in-house JeanRichard JR1000 movement, each watch is crafted with the same passion for precision MV shares in bike design.
